Speculators Trim Bullish Soybean Bets as Net Long Positions Edge Lower

Speculative interest in U.S. soybeans eased slightly in the latest reporting period, with net long positions slipping from their prior peak. According to the latest data released on 15 May 2026, CFTC soybeans speculative net positions declined to 224.0K from a previous level of 232.2K.

The pullback suggests that some traders may be locking in profits or adopting a more cautious stance after the earlier buildup in bullish bets. While the net position remains firmly in positive territory, the moderation in speculative exposure could signal a reassessment of near-term price momentum in the U.S. soybean market. Market participants will be watching upcoming supply, demand, and weather developments closely to gauge whether this shift marks a brief pause or the start of a broader repositioning.
